.speedoco-custom-apps-0-x-bodyEmpleo{width:100%;max-width:600px;margin:0 auto;padding:20px;font-family:Arial,sans-serif}.speedoco-custom-apps-0-x-row{display:grid;gap:20px;margin-bottom:16px}.speedoco-custom-apps-0-x-inputTwoEmpleo{flex:1}.speedoco-custom-apps-0-x-contemailEmpleo,.speedoco-custom-apps-0-x-contNameEmpleo{width:100%;height:40px;padding:0 12px;border:1px solid #ccc;border-radius:4px;font-size:14px;box-sizing:border-box}.speedoco-custom-apps-0-x-contemailEmpleo:focus,.speedoco-custom-apps-0-x-contemailEmpleoSelect:focus,.speedoco-custom-apps-0-x-contNameEmpleo:focus{outline:none;border-color:#888}.speedoco-custom-apps-0-x-contemailEmpleoSelect{width:100%;height:40px;padding:0 12px;border:1px solid #ccc;border-radius:4px;font-size:14px;background:#fff;-webkit-appearance:none;-moz-appearance:none;appearance:none;background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g width='14' height='8'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ath d='M1 1l6 6 6-6' stroke='%23666' stroke-width='2' fill='none'/%3E%3C/svg%3E");background-repeat:no-repeat;background-position:right 12px center;background-size:14px 8px}.speedoco-custom-apps-0-x-files_form{margin-bottom:16px}.speedoco-custom-apps-0-x-files_container{display:flex;align-items:center;gap:12px}.speedoco-custom-apps-0-x-inputArchivoAdjunto{display:none}.speedoco-custom-apps-0-x-customFileUpload{flex:1;background-color:#fff}.speedoco-custom-apps-0-x-customFileUpload,.speedoco-custom-apps-0-x-files{padding:0 12px;height:40px;line-height:40px;border:1px solid #ccc;border-radius:4px;cursor:pointer;font-size:14px}.speedoco-custom-apps-0-x-files{background:#f5f5f5}.speedoco-custom-apps-0-x-fileDescription{font-size:12px;color:#666;margin-top:4px;flex-basis:100%}.speedoco-custom-apps-0-x-inputTwoEmpleoCheck{margin-bottom:24px}.speedoco-custom-apps-0-x-inputTwoEmpleoCheck label{font-size:14px;display:flex;align-items:center;gap:8px}.speedoco-custom-apps-0-x-inputTwoEmpleoCheck a{color:#004aad;text-decoration:none}.speedoco-custom-apps-0-x-inputTwoEmpleoCheck a:hover{text-decoration:underline}.speedoco-custom-apps-0-x-contPrincEnviarEmpleo{text-align:right}.speedoco-custom-apps-0-x-contenviarEmpleo{background-color:#e60000;color:#fff;border:none;padding:0 24px;height:40px;line-height:40px;font-size:14px;text-transform:uppercase;border-radius:4px;cursor:pointer}.speedoco-custom-apps-0-x-contenviarEmpleo:hover{background-color:#c50000}.speedoco-custom-apps-0-x-bodyEmpleoLast{padding:40px;text-align:center;font-family:Arial,sans-serif}.speedoco-custom-apps-0-x-bodyEmpleoLast h1{font-size:24px;color:#28a745}